Yes command is one of those commands that can help you look cool while using the Linux terminal. It basically regurgitates whatever you place in front of it until you tell it to stop with the “CTRL + C” command combo.
Yes command is used to display a string repeatedly until when terminated or killed using [Ctrl + C] as follows.
$ yes “This is ItsChromeOS – Your hub for all things Chrome OS”
